California POST Midterm Exam
Questions With Verified Solutions.
First Amendment - Answer Freedom of religion, speech, the press, assembly, and to petition the
government for redress of grievances.
Fourth Amendment - Answer Freedom from unreasonable search and seizure.
Fifth Amendment - Answer Freedom from being tried twice for the same crime, and from self-
incrimination.
Sixth Amendment - Answer Right to be told of charges, have a speedy trial, have a public trial by
impartial jury, right to confront witnesses, and right to counsel.
Eighth Amendment - Answer Freedom of excessive bail, and cruel and unusual punishment.
Fourteenth Amendment - Answer Right of defendant in judicial proceedings, the requisites for trial,
due process, and right to equal protection of the laws.
Components of the Criminal Justice System - Answer - Law Enforcement
- Judicial
- Corrections
Goal of the Criminal Justice System... - Answer - Guarantee Due Process
- Prevent Crime
- Protect Life and Property
- Uphold and Enforce the Law
- Dispense Equal Justice
- Apprehend Offenders
, - Assure Victim's Rights
What is a constitution? - Answer a written document that embodies the basic laws of a nation or state.
It identifies the powers and duties of the government and the rights afforded to all individuals.
What is the law making framework of the government? - Answer - Executive Branch
- Legislative Branch
- Judicial Branch
What is the Bill of Rights? - Answer The first ten amendments to the constitution, ratified by Congress
in December 1791.
